Dealer told me I need a power steering flush?

I took my 99 4runner into the dealer a few weeks ago to have my car's alignment done... I was told I need a power steering fluid flush. He told me that my fluid is old and dirty. I cant find anything about flushing it! Did he just make this up?! I mean.... i've NEVER heard of that in my life!!! Cant I just suck it out and put new ATF fluid in?

Anyone heard of this???

lots of useful information in this thread related to your rig, don't know if yours imparticular needs it.. i say if it's not making noise when steering and you aren't having any issues in that area (besides the alignment) then it's 'probably' ok. toyota is notorious for their 'complimentarly calls' to tack on service here and there once it's in the shop.. some people have experienced toyota trying to add on $2500 in odds and ends.

good luck with your stealer!
